引言
随着汽车电子技术的不断发展,CAN(控制器局域网)总线在汽车系统中扮演着越来越重要的角色。CAN总线作为一种高可靠性的通信协议,广泛应用于汽车、工业、医疗等领域。本文将深入探讨CAN总线检测系统的原理、故障排查方法以及优化设计策略,帮助读者更好地理解和应对CAN总线相关问题。
CAN总线检测系统概述
1. CAN总线基本原理
CAN总线是一种多主从网络,支持多个设备同时通信。其基本原理是利用差分信号传输,提高抗干扰能力,并通过CRC校验保证数据传输的准确性。
2. CAN总线检测系统组成
CAN总线检测系统通常由以下几部分组成:
- CAN控制器:负责发送和接收CAN总线上的数据。
- CAN收发器:将CAN控制器产生的差分信号转换为标准CAN总线信号。
- 诊断工具:用于检测CAN总线上的故障和性能。
- 故障诊断软件:对CAN总线数据进行解析和分析。
故障排查方法
1. 确定故障现象
首先,需要明确故障现象,如通信中断、数据错误等。
2. 使用诊断工具进行初步检测
通过诊断工具读取CAN总线上的数据,分析故障原因。
3. 定位故障节点
根据故障现象和诊断数据,确定故障节点。
4. 故障排除
针对故障节点,采取相应的措施进行排除。
优化设计策略
1. 选择合适的CAN控制器和收发器
根据实际需求,选择性能稳定、兼容性好的CAN控制器和收发器。
2. 优化CAN总线拓扑结构
合理设计CAN总线拓扑结构,降低网络延迟和干扰。
3. 增强故障诊断能力
开发功能强大的故障诊断软件,提高故障排查效率。
4. 提高系统可靠性
采取冗余设计,提高CAN总线系统的可靠性。
案例分析
以下是一个实际案例,说明如何运用CAN总线检测系统进行故障排查:
1. 故障现象
某汽车CAN总线通信中断,导致部分功能失效。
2. 故障排查
通过诊断工具读取CAN总线数据,发现故障节点为发动机控制单元。
3. 故障排除
针对发动机控制单元,更换故障部件,恢复正常通信。
总结
CAN总线检测系统在汽车、工业等领域发挥着重要作用。掌握CAN总线检测系统的原理、故障排查方法和优化设计策略,有助于提高CAN总线系统的可靠性和稳定性。本文从多个角度对CAN总线检测系统进行了深入剖析,希望能为读者提供有益的参考。
